About this fabric

This 612gsm fabric has a strong upholstery weight, with a 139cm usable width and a 30m standard length. Irregular charcoal blocks and angular silhouettes interrupt the pale linen-toned ground, creating a high-contrast pattern softened by the visible fleck and grain of the weave. The design repeats every 51.5cm vertically and 33.5cm horizontally, giving the medium-scale geometry a consistent, rhythmic layout across a larger upholstered surface. The charcoal reads deep and slightly softened against the warmer beige, producing a grounded, graphic colourway with understated depth.

How to use it

Use Espen Charcoal/Linen on a tailored armchair, sofa or bench where its charcoal-and-beige contrast can act as the room’s principal pattern. Pair it with warm timber, aged leather and quiet taupe textiles to bring out the linen tone without competing with the geometric weave.

A substantial, textural geometric weave that brings graphic contrast to upholstered seating and occasional pieces.
